I am a media professional who has worked in the publishing world for 25 years, mainly as a sports + fitness writer. As the media world as evolved, so did I. After I co-authoring the book Run Like a Mother in 2010, I expanded my focus to community building, both via social media and face-to-face interactions, as well as becoming proficient in a range of communication forms (newsletter, website + blog posts, podcast, and videos).

Co-Founder And Chief Training DirectorAnother Mother Runner Jan 2010 - PresentDenver, Co• Co-Author of Run Like a Mother (Andrews McMeel, 2010); Train Like a Mother (2012); Tales From Another Mother Runner (Andrews McMeel, 2015).• Created and trademarked another mother runner brand; expanded it to attract 15 national marketing partners annually.• Designed and oversee another mother runner website; write or edit 15 posts monthly.• Produce daily and monthly e-newsletters, growing subscribers to 35,000+.• Oversee creative content, including social media campaigns and strategies. (100,,000+ fans on Facebook; 8,400+ followers on Twitter; 34,000 + followers on Instagram.)• Created AMR virtual Challenges in 2013, comprehensive training plans with support from first mile to finish line of 5k, 10k, half-marathon and marathon (2,000 paying entries in two years). • In 2016, launched Train Like a Mother Club to host comprehensive training programs, including running, triathlon, ultra, nutrition, and sports psych; helped coaches designed programs, and created all supplemental materials, including videos and weekly newsletters.• Co-host regular podcast (average 120,000 downloads/month).• Speak at running stores and race expos, including RunDisney and Rock ‘n’ Roll marathon events. -
Freelance WriterSports + Fitness Publications Jun 2000 - Jan 2012Denver, CoMagazines• Originate and pitch story ideas, as well as complete assignments already conceived by editors, for national magazines; track down appropriate sources and resources to thoroughly understand topic; conduct research in person, via phone interviews and on Internet; execute copy per editor’s instructions, including story’s length, tone and angle; actively participate in editing stages. • Focus on athlete profiles and competition coverage, with emphasis on Olympic and non-mainstream events and women’s sports and fitness. Expertise in exercise physiology, fitness, workouts and gear. • Current contributing editor at Runner’s World; position requires brainstorming sessions with editors, initiating content and taking on stories developed by others. • Former editor-at-large at Sports Illustrated Women, contributing editor at Women’s Health, Health and Shape and 2008 Olympics news reporter for ESPN: The Magazine. • Nominated for 2005 National Magazine Award in the service category for how-to-buy-a-house, 6,000-word article for Budget Living. • Additional pieces published in Play: The New York Times Sports Magazine, Sports Illustrated Adventure, Outside, Bicycling, Marie Claire, National Geographic Adventure, Newsweek, Real Simple, Men’s Fitness, Yoga Journal, Fitness, Glamour and Cooking Light. Books• Co-author of Run Like a Mother (Andrews McMeel, 2010); Train Like a Mother (Andrews McMeel March 2012); Smart at Heart (Ten Speed Press, 2011); Tales from Another Mother Runner (Andrews McMeel, 2015).• Contributed essays to Woman’s Best Friend, dog-centric anthology; Cat Woman, cat-centric anthology, P.S. What I Didn’t Tell You, personal essays; and Southwest Flavors, cookbook produced by Santa Fe School of Cooking.

Senior EditorSports Illustrated For Women Dec 1998 - Jun 2000New York, NyContributed to all aspects of start-up, bimonthly magazine. Wrote and edited stories of all lengths; orchestrated photo acts; covered the Women’s Soccer World Cup, Goodwill Games. Coordinated “Best Jock Schools for Women,” annual 14-page special section.

Writer/ReporterEspn: The Magazine Oct 1996 - Jan 1998New York, NyWriter/Reporter. Covered extreme and Olympic sports, including attending the X-Games and similar events. Coordinated Total Access, a regular, investigative feature; researched, wrote and fact-checked stories; assisted with NBA, college sports and soccer coverage.
